Been packing a Model 7KS in .350 mag for a few years, and its become one of my main go-to guns for timber.

few years ago, i was getting down outa the ladder after an evening hunt..... had popped a doe about an hour before and she fell in her tracks, so i let her lay, thinking i might have a buck pass through. Never happened, so at dark , i'm clipping the gun onto the paracord rope to lower it down, and i get tangled up somehow and down goes that KS in a 20 foot freefall. cry

SSSSSCHHHHIIITTTTT!!!!!!!!!!!! mad

gun falls muzzle first, and ends up sticking straight into the ground like an arrow. i run down the ladder like a wild squirrel, and pull it outa the ground. crown is intact, barrel not dinged, only had a couple of slight exterior surface scratches. i was damn lucky.

decided last year i'd get the finish upgraded to a full cerakote.
